diff --git a/rslib/BUILD.bazel b/rslib/BUILD.bazel index 0ef18421c..59f30c0ff 100644 --- a/rslib/BUILD.bazel +++ b/rslib/BUILD.bazel @@ -159,10 +159,15 @@ rust_test( "//rslib/cargo:futures", "//rslib/cargo:itertools", "//rslib/cargo:linkcheck", - "//rslib/cargo:reqwest", "//rslib/cargo:strum", "//rslib/cargo:tokio", - ], + ] + select({ + # rustls on Linux + "//platforms:linux_x86_64": ["@reqwest_rustls//:reqwest"], + "//platforms:linux_arm64": ["@reqwest_rustls//:reqwest"], + # native tls on other platforms + "//conditions:default": ["//rslib/cargo:reqwest"], + }), ) rustfmt_test(